OBJECTIVE: To analyze changes in volume and position of target regions and organs at risk (OARs) during radiotherapy for esophageal cancer patients.Entities:
Keywords: adaptive radiotherapy; esophageal cancer; geometric center deviation; target retraction; volume changed ratio

DTI changes under different radiation doses (cm).
| Treated Time | 0 | 1 week | 2 weeks | 3 weeks | 4 weeks | 5 weeks |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| (Treated dose) | (0 Gy) | (10 Gy) | (20 Gy) | (30 Gy) | (40 Gy) | (50 Gy) |
| DTIheart | 15.61 ± 2.96 | 15.49 ± 2.82* | 15.33 ± 2.92* | 15.22 ± 2.84* | 15.18 ± 2.77* | 15.16 ± 2.77* |
| DTIspinal-cord | 7.22 ± 1.53 | 7.20 ± 1.56 | 7.12 ± 1.50 | 7.23 ± 1.54 | 7.22 ± 1.56 | 7.21 ± 1.60 |
All were compared with plan levels.
*P < 0.01, using Wilcoxon signed-rank test.
DTIheart, changes in distance to isocenter of heart; DTIspinal-cord, changes in distance to isocenter of spinal-cord.
